Course Content

• Principles of Biopreservation & Cryopreservation
• Cell Biology for Biopreservation: Membrane integrity, cellular stress responses
• Cryoprotective Agents (CPAs): Selection, mechanism of action, toxicity
• Biopreservation Techniques: Freezing, Vitrification, Drying
• Advanced Biopreservation of Tissues & Organs: Ischemic injury, perfusion techniques
• Quality Control & Assurance in Biopreservation: sterility testing, viability assays
• Regulatory Aspects of Biopreservation: GMP, safety guidelines
• Biobanking & Biorepository Management: sample storage, inventory management
• Applications of Biopreservation in Regenerative Medicine: stem cell cryopreservation, tissue engineering
• Emerging Technologies in Biopreservation: Nanotechnology, gene editing

Career Role (Biopreservation Techniques) Description
Cryopreservation Specialist Experts in freezing and storing biological materials, crucial for research and medical advancements. High demand in UK biotech.
Biopreservation Scientist Develops and optimizes biopreservation protocols, ensuring long-term viability of cells, tissues, and organs. Leading role in regenerative medicine.
Biobanking Technician Manages and maintains biobanks, overseeing the storage and retrieval of biological samples. Essential for clinical trials and research.
Cell Culture and Biopreservation Engineer Designs and implements efficient biopreservation systems; vital for large-scale bioprocessing and manufacturing. Growing UK industry focus.
